THE COLDSTREAM GUARDS ASSOCIATION
To maintain an organisation whereby the principle of "Once a Coldstreamer always a Coldstreamer" can be sustained.
Financial health, per its FY2024 accounts
The accounts state that the charity reported a net deficit of £17,255 for the year ended 31 December 2024, resulting in total unrestricted funds decreasing from £226,762 to £209,507. The trustees confirmed that reserves are held adequate to fund central activities and local charitable efforts, with no material uncertainties affecting the going concern status disclosed.
What the accounts disclose
“Income from Charitable activities, which are branch lunches and socials were £36,745 (2023: £36,546).”
